What's The Definition Of Liberalistic?
[adj] having or demonstrating belief in the essential goodness of man and the autonomy of the individual; favoring civil and political liberties, government by law with the consent of the governed, and protection from arbitrary authority
Synonyms | Synonyms for Liberalistic: liberal Related Terms | Find terms related to Liberalistic: See Also | Liberalistic In Webster's Dictionary \Lib`er*al*is"tic\ (-[i^]s"t[i^]k), a.
Pertaining to, or characterized by, liberalism; as,
liberalistic opinions.
